Shadcn.io is not affiliated with official shadcn/ui
Onboarding Template Selection
Template picker onboarding block for React and Next.js with selectable rows, ring state indicators, and start button built with TypeScript, shadcn/ui, and Tailwind CSS
Streamline project kickoff with this React and Next.js template selection onboarding block built in TypeScript. Features four selectable template rows for Blank, Marketing Site, SaaS Dashboard, and E-commerce with Lucide React icons, descriptions, a ring-2 selected state indicator, and a primary Start with Template button. Built with shadcn/ui Button component, Framer Motion staggered entrance animations, and Tailwind CSS. Perfect for SaaS onboarding flows, project scaffolding wizards, and first-run template pickers in React applications.
Related Components
Workspace Setup Onboarding
Workspace name and URL configuration
Use Case Onboarding
Use case selection for personalization
First Project Onboarding
Initial project creation wizard
Sample Data Onboarding
Sample data import interface
Plan Selection Onboarding
Pricing plan picker with features
Goal Setting Onboarding
User goal definition interface
FAQ
Was this page helpful?
Sign in to leave feedback.
Team Invite
Team invitation onboarding block for React and Next.js with email input, member list, pending badges, and send action built with TypeScript, shadcn/ui, and Tailwind CSS
Terms Consent
Terms acceptance onboarding block for React and Next.js with consent checkboxes, read links, and conditional agree button built with TypeScript, shadcn/ui, and Tailwind CSS